WindowBlinds to msstyles

Hi,

is there any way to convert WindowsBlind theme into .msstyles format?

26,511 views 6 replies
Reply #1 Top

Yes, Open the Windowblinds skin in Skin studio, then open and save all the Parts/images of the skin (that you want to use) in Photoshop and save them to disk.

-Put them all in to the "MsStyles-Editor" of your choice and create your new MsStyle ;)

-Other than this procedure -NO
